Rick Townsend, PhD

Rick Townsend, PhD

Author | Independent Historian | Speaker | Seminar Leader — field_542d8190101fc

Rick Townsend is a retired Air Force fighter pilot and airline pilot. His passion for aviation allowed him to fly aircraft as old as the T-33, as advanced as the F-15 and as large as the Boeing 777....

Rick Townsend is a retired Air Force fighter pilot and airline pilot. His passion for aviation allowed him to fly aircraft as old as the T-33, as advanced as the F-15 and as large as the Boeing 777. His other passions revolve around history, and the evidence for the Christian faith. This passion drove Rick to pursue a Ph.D. in History of Ideas from the University of Texas at Dallas. His 2021 dissertation centered on William Jennings Bryan’s focus on fundamental rights as a basis for his arguments in support of various social and political causes. A major portion of that research naturally included the Scopes trial. Rick is using his retirement as an independent historian. He continues researching issues related to intelligent design and evolution, and leads seminars on the intersection of science and faith. These seminars center on evidence for the reliability, historicity and veracity of the Biblical narratives.
